Choosing the Right Bonnet for Your Hair Type
Selecting the perfect bonnet isn't a one-size-fits-all situation - your hair type and protective style needs should guide your choice. Let's dive into the specific features you'll want to look for based on your unique hair texture.
Bonnets for Type 3 Curly Hair
Type 3 curls require specific considerations when choosing a nighttime bonnet:
- Size: Medium to large bonnets accommodate springy curl patterns
- Material: Double-layered satin provides extra protection
- Elastic Band: Opt for gentle, wide bands that won't create tension marks
- Style: Consider reversible bonnets for versatility

Bonnets for Type 4 Coily Hair
Type 4 hair textures benefit from bonnets with these features:
- Extra-Large Size: Accommodates volume and length
- Reinforced Seams: Prevents splitting from dense hair types
- Adjustable Drawstring: Allows customizable fit
- Deep Interior: Protects high-volume styles

Protective Style Considerations
Different protective styles require specific bonnet features:
Box Braids & Locs
- XL or jumbo-sized bonnets
- Stretchy material for flexibility
- Reinforced stitching at stress points
- Extended length coverage
Twist-Outs & Bantu Knots
- Structured bonnets with height
- Soft elastic that won't dent styles
- Breathable fabric layers
- Secure fit without compression
Material Quality Markers
High-quality bonnets should feature:
- 100% mulberry silk or premium satin
- Double-stitched edges
- Smooth interior lining
- Durable elastic or drawstring
- Breathable fabric weight
When shopping for your bonnet, test these features:
- Stretch the elastic to check resilience
- Examine seam construction
- Verify size measurements
- Check fabric thickness
- Look for smooth, even stitching
Your bonnet should feel comfortable while staying securely in place throughout the night. A proper fit allows enough room for your hair to move without creating friction or tension points that could damage your strands.

Best Practices for Nighttime Hair Care Beyond Bonnets
Your nightly hair protection routine deserves more than just a bonnet. Let's explore additional accessories that create the perfect protective environment for your precious strands.
Essential Protective Accessories:
- Silk Pillowcases: Replace cotton pillowcases with silk alternatives to reduce friction when your bonnet shifts during sleep
- Satin Scrunchies: Secure longer styles with gentle, non-damaging holds
- Silk Scarves: Perfect for layering under bonnets or as an alternative for shorter styles
Creating Your Ultimate Nighttime Setup:
- Start with a silk pillowcase as your base protection
- Use satin scrunchies to create loose, protective sections
- Layer your bonnet on top for maximum coverage
- Add a silk scarf for extra security with longer styles
Pro Tips for Maximum Protection:
Position your hair high on the crown when wearing a bonnet to prevent slipping
Create a "pineapple" style with a loose satin scrunchie for length retention
Double-layer protection (scarf + bonnet) works wonders for maintaining intricate styles
Keep spare accessories on hand for rotation while others are being cleaned
These protective measures work together to create a friction-free environment that preserves your hairstyle's integrity. Combining multiple protective accessories helps distribute pressure evenly across your hair, reducing the risk of breakage and maintaining moisture levels throughout the night.

Maintaining Hair Health Between Wash Days with Refresh Routines
Your hair care journey doesn't pause between wash days. A strategic refresh routine keeps your curls bouncy and hydrated throughout the week. Here's how to maintain that fresh-from-the-salon look:
Daily Moisture Boost
- Mist your hair with a water-based refresher spray
- Apply a lightweight leave-in conditioner focusing on the ends
- Use the praying hands method to distribute products evenly
Quick Detangling Tips
- Start from the bottom and work your way up
- Use your fingers or a wide-tooth comb
- Divide hair into small sections for thorough detangling
- Never detangle dry hair - always add moisture first
Pro Refresh Techniques
- Pineapple your hair at night to maintain curl pattern
- Spot-treat dry areas with a moisturizing cream
- Use a spray bottle with water and oil mix for quick revivals
- Apply products in sections for even distribution
Your refresh routine should adapt to your hair's needs. Some days might require a full re-moisturizing session, while others need just a light mist. Listen to your hair - it'll tell you what it needs. Caring for Your Bonnets and Accessories: Tips for Longevity
Your bonnets work hard to protect your hair - let's make sure they stay in pristine condition! Here's how to keep your hair protection accessories performing at their best:
Washing Your Bonnets
Hand washing (recommended method):
- Use lukewarm water and mild soap
- Gently squeeze and massage to clean
- Avoid wringing or twisting
- Air dry flat or hang
Machine washing (when necessary):
- Place bonnet in a mesh laundry bag
- Use delicate cycle with cold water
- Skip the dryer - air dry only
Smart Storage Solutions
- Keep bonnets in a dedicated drawer or container
- Store flat or loosely hung to maintain shape
- Avoid folding or cramming into tight spaces
- Keep away from direct sunlight to prevent fabric degradation
Rotation Schedule
- Own 2-3 bonnets for regular rotation
- Switch bonnets every 3-4 days
- Replace bonnets showing signs of wear:
- Stretched elastic
- Loose stitching
- Fabric thinning
- Loss of shape
Quick Care Tips
- Avoid sleeping with wet hair in your bonnet
- Remove makeup before putting on your bonnet
- Check elastic integrity regularly
- Spot clean as needed between washes
